Can clustering algorithms be used to identify patterns in high-frequency stock market data?5 answersClustering algorithms can indeed be utilized to identify patterns in high-frequency stock market data. These algorithms play a crucial role in grouping financial instruments based on their stochastic properties over time. Various clustering methods like K-means, MST, and hierarchical approaches have been widely applied in financial fields, including credit scoring, stock market analysis, portfolio selection, and trading strategy development. By analyzing anomalies in high-frequency market data and utilizing clustering techniques, market participants can gain a deeper understanding of market dynamics and extract valuable insights for informed trading strategies. Additionally, clustering methods such as K-means and EM algorithms have shown effectiveness in analyzing stock price movements, highlighting similar patterns among companies within the same cluster.
What's the best machine learning algorithm for modeling equity returns?5 answersBased on the research findings from multiple studies, the best machine learning algorithm for modeling equity returns is the random forest method. These studies compared various machine learning methods such as penalized linear models, support vector regression, random forests, gradient boosted trees, and neural networks, demonstrating that machine learning techniques significantly enhance stock return predictions compared to traditional linear regression models. Additionally, the random forest method consistently outperformed other algorithms across different target variables, showcasing its superiority in forecasting equity returns. While deep learning methods like LSTM have shown promise in handling non-stationary time series, the random forest method remains the top choice for accurately predicting equity returns based on the research evidence available.
What is the effectiveness of machine learning algorithms in predicting stock market trends?5 answersMachine learning algorithms have shown effectiveness in predicting stock market trends. Various algorithms such as SOM, SVR, RNN, LSTM, ARIMA, TBATS, Holt-Winters, Random Forest, ANN, and Linear Regression have been utilized for this purpose. The experiments and testing conducted in different studies have revealed high prediction accuracy, with peak accuracy reaching approximately 91% across different algorithms. While complex deep learning models like RNN and LSTM have shown strong performance, simpler models like Linear Regression, MLP, and the Theta Model have also yielded impressive results, with a Mean Absolute Percentage Error (MAPE) of 1. Additionally, the random forest model has been found to provide more accurate predictions. These findings emphasize the effectiveness of machine learning algorithms, both complex and simpler models, in generating precise and dependable forecasts for stock market trends.
How can artificial intelligence be used to analyze the stock market?5 answersArtificial intelligence (AI) can be used to analyze the stock market by processing large amounts of data and making predictions based on that analysis. AI techniques such as machine learning algorithms and natural language processing can help discover trends and forecast changes in the stock market by analyzing data from various sources like news stories, earnings reports, and social media. However, it is important to note that the stock market is influenced by numerous unknown events, making forecasting challenging. To overcome this challenge, AI predictions can be used as one of several inputs in a well-diversified investment plan to achieve accurate stock market predictions. Additionally, employing sentiment analysis on news related to the stock market can provide valuable insights for traders in making timely and accurate decisions.
How does algorithmic trading impact the stock market?5 answersAlgorithmic trading has a significant impact on the stock market. It eliminates psychological barriers to trading and ensures significant returns on investments. High-frequency trading (HFT), a form of algorithmic trading, has gained traction globally and positively affects market quality by improving liquidity and reducing short-term volatility. Algorithmic trading has been criticized for its speed and potential negative impacts, but evidence of these ill effects is yet to be found. Algorithmic arbitrage, a common algorithmic trading strategy, is found to be the most profitable due to its high frequency and efficiency. However, the impact of algorithmic trading on market volatility is still subject to discussion. The increasing activity of algorithmic trading is likely to lead to new future regulations due to the risks it carries.
Can machine learning be used to improve stock chart pattern recognition?5 answersMachine learning can be used to improve stock chart pattern recognition. Various machine learning algorithms, such as linear regression, have been implemented to detect stock chart patterns with high accuracy. However, machine learning-based trading systems tend to generate a large number of false signals and may not effectively consider the information provided by candlestick patterns. To address this, a proposed approach decouples the machine learning and pattern recognition steps, selectively filtering out potentially unreliable trading recommendations based on recognized graphical patterns. Another study explores the use of machine learning methods, including popular models like multilayer perceptron network and long short-term memory neural networks, to improve pattern recognition and generate profitable trading signals. Additionally, the performances of CNN and LSTM have been evaluated for recognizing common chart patterns in stock historical data.